Dear Friends,

 This donation page includes a picture of Ezra at Slide Rock State Park near Sedona, Arizona. This picture captures Ezra - fearless, athletic, uninhibited, adventurous, and as always, the ability to make a hysterical face when the camera was on him. There are many pictures of Ezra that I enjoy looking at but this picture captures who he was and creates such a deep and anguished longing to have that unique and fun filled personality back in our lives.

 We are nearing our annual adventure which celebrates Ezra’s life while raising money for OneFamily, whose mission it is to support families who have lost loved ones to terrorism.

 This year, the trip (Oct. 20-22) will include a hike on Friday, a hike on Shabbos in Sedona, followed by a significant hike and/or run on Sunday starting at 6:00AM.  The day will include three hiking options, hard, medium and easy.

This idea started while I was sitting in our living room sitting shiva. We had the most incredible support from countless individuals, but I wanted to run away. I wanted to find some trail in the middle of the woods where I could scream and cry as loud as I could and I wanted to just keep running. I started to think about where I could go and how long I could go. But over time I realized that all the effort and attention from family and friends and from those we did not even know, was helping and I realized it was better to run with family and friends rather than run alone. I decided that I don’t want to remember Nov. 19th 2015, I want to remember Oct. 1st, Erev Rosh Hashana, the day Ezra was born, and I want to go to the places where Ezra had been, as a way to celebrate his life.

In the last 6 years we have raised about $80,000. As is our tradition we are asking for just $18 from each person. 18! Which represents life and represents the 18 years of Ezra’s life. We are thankful for the time we had with him. One Family has introduced us to so many people who lost loved ones well before the age of 18 and our children, while attending camps in Israel, met kids of all ages who lost their parents or siblings. Please, help us support OneFamily and go to their website https://onefamilytogether.org/ to see what they are doing with your support.

With Love, Ari and Ruth and Family
